The Niederheide Primary School in Hohen Neuendorf is trend-setting in many ways: as the first school in Germany with a plus-energy standard, the building meets the highest requirements in terms of sustainability in both the building and the operation itself. In addition, the architecture of the IBUS Architects and Engineers, Berlin/Bremen effectively demonstrate how it is possible to design a school environment in which pupils and teachers can breathe and feel totally comfortable.

Bauhaus Architecture in Celle, Lower Saxony, Southeast Germany
Bauhaus Architecture in Celle, Germany
The picturesque Guelph Palace and the modern 24-hour art museum located next to the impressive Bomann Museum in the Old Town are well-known. Less well-known, however, is that Celle is effectively the birthplace of ‘Neues Bauen’ (‘New Objectivity’ – modern functional building design) and with regard to Bauhaus architecture it ranks in the same league as the towns of Weimar and Dessau.

Grant for Bauhaus Building, Dessau, Saxony-Anhalt, eastern Germany
Bauhaus Dessau building - German architecture news
photo © Bauhaus Dessau Foundation, photo © Yvonne Tenschert
Bauhaus Building Dessau
The Getty Foundation announced $1.66 million in architectural conservation grants dedicated to twelve significant 20th century buildings. Among this year’s most recognizable projects is the revered Dessau structure designed by architect Walter Gropius, who incorporated design features that would ultimately become synonymous with modern architecture around the world.

C.A.R.L. auditorium, RWTH Aachen University, Aachen, Northwest Germany
Design: Schmidt Hammer Lassen Architects
CARL Auditorium - German architecture news
photographers : Margot Gottschling and Michael Rasche
CARL Auditorium at RWTH Aachen University
One of the largest and most modern lecture facilities in Europe: the new 14,000 sqm facility named C.A.R.L. (Central Auditorium for Research and Learning) offers space for over 4,000 students. This property comprises 11 lecture halls, 16 seminar rooms, break-out spaces and cafés, as well as housing the University’s physics collection, storage spaces, workspaces and a large bicycle parking basement.
